Apple threatens to BAN iOS apps that secretly record users' iPhone screens


Apple is cracking down on apps that secretly record your screen activity. A TechCrunch investigation revealed that many companies like Expedia, Hollister and Hotels.com are using a third-party analytics tool in their apps that lets them record users' screen activity. App developers record the screen and play them back to see what people did in the app to see what people liked, disliked, or if an error occurred. This means that every tap, button push and keyboard entry is recorded, screenshotted and sent back to the app developers.
